Panerai Radiomir Eilean: PAM01243 a watch inspired by a classic sailing yacht.

Panerai has released a new watch called, Radiomir Eilean with the reference number PAM01243 inspired by the classic yacht Eilean having both being launched in 1936.

This is also in occurrence of the Eilean arrival in Portofino during this month (July 2021), should you be fortunate enough to be around the iconic sea town you’ll be spotting the famous sailboat on the waters.  

Eilean Sailboat

Eilean is a the 22 metres (70 foot) classic ketch belonging to Italian watchmaker Panerai. The sailboat was designed and built in 1936 by William Fife, a third generation yacht designer and builder, famous for having designed two contededer boats participating at the America’s cup. Immediately recognisible in her elegance she was built for the Fulton brothers, Scottish steel merchants. The yacht passed ownership until she was used as a charter business vessel.

In 2006 Angelo Bonati, then the Panerai CEO, spotted the yacht while visiting Antigua in a state of disrepair. Bonati arranged for the yacht to be restored by a shipyard in Italy for few years and she was re-launched in 2009 as part of an advertising campaign for the Panerai brand.

Panerai Radiomir Eilean

This model pays homage to the first Radiomir, created by Guido Panerai to support marine missions, combined with features that embrace the aesthetic of the William Fife-designed Eilean.

The 45mm watch case is created from matte patina steel and sports distinctly nautical features that superyacht owners and enthusiasts can appreciate.

 

The face has been designed evoking of Eilean’s teak deck, complete with a dragon engraving on the left side of the case replicating the same emblem that decorates the yacht’s hull. Within the case, the watch hands are  consistent with Panerai heritage and the legendary sandwich numerals.

The Caseback

The case back bears an engraving that reads “Eilean 1936” and is identical to the one located on the ship’s boom. It’s complete with a dragon engraving on the left side of the case replicating the same emblem that decorates the yacht’s hull.

The strap:

The watch strap itself is made from leather produced in Panerai’s place of origin, Tuscany, and is adorned with intricate hand stitching inspired by the lacing found on Eilean’s sails. This stitching also ensures that the strap will endure tough conditions when worn on board the Scamosciato Brown with beige stitching is meant to be heritage of early diving watches with leather straps. 

Both the original Radiomir and Eilean, the yacht that became a part of Panerai history, were created in 1936. The Radiomir Eilean honours the underlying bond between these two legends.


The Tech Specs


MOVEMENT: Hand-wound mechanical, P.6000 calibre. Power reserve 3 days, one barrel.

FUNCTIONS: Hours, minutes

CASE: Diameter 45mm, Engraved Patina steel

BEZEL: Patina steel

BACK: Engraved Patina steel

DIAL: Brown with luminous Arabic numerals and hour markers. Small seconds at 9 o'clock

WATER RESISTANCE: "10 bar (~100 metres)"

STRAP: Scamosciato Brown, Beige Stitching, 27.0/22.0 Standard size
